July 2026 Skywatching: Venus, Moon, Meteors, and Milky Way

July 2026 promises a spectacular celestial display for skywatchers. The month will feature a prominent Venus shining brightly after sunset, a delicate crescent moon near Mars and the Pleiades before dawn, and the full Buck Moon later in the month. Additionally, July marks the beginning of meteor season with the Perseid shower starting, followed by the peaks of the Delta Aquariids and Alpha Capricornids, though bright moonlight may obscure fainter meteors.
